Proportion of population covered by at least a 2G mobile network in India
India: Proportion of population covered by at least a 2G mobile network was 99.3% in 2024. ▲ Rising
Proportion of population covered by at least a 2G mobile network in India, 2000–2024
Source: United Nations Statistics Division, SDG Global Database.
Analysis
The most recent figure for proportion of population covered by at least a 2g mobile network in India is 99.3%, measured in 2024. That is the highest value across all 17 years on record.
Compared with earlier readings it is up 0.1% on the previous year and up 6.2% over ten years.
Over the whole period, proportion of population covered by at least a 2g mobile network in India peaked at 99.3% in 2024 and was at its lowest, 21.1%, in 2000.
That places India 98th out of 196 countries with data for 2024, putting it in the middle of the range.
The long-run direction has been consistently rising across the 17 years of available data.
Proportion of population covered by at least a 2G mobile network in India, year by year
| Year | Value | Change |
|---|---|---|
| 2000 | 21.1% | — |
| 2001 | 21.1% | +0.0% |
| 2005 | 30.5% | +44.5% |
| 2006 | 60.9% | +99.7% |
| 2007 | 70.0% | +14.9% |
| 2009 | 83.0% | +18.6% |
| 2013 | 93.5% | +12.6% |
| 2015 | 95.0% | +1.6% |
| 2016 | 96.0% | +1.1% |
| 2017 | 97.0% | +1.0% |
| 2018 | 97.0% | +0.0% |
| 2019 | 99.1% | +2.1% |
| 2020 | 99.1% | +0.1% |
| 2021 | 99.2% | +0.1% |
| 2022 | 99.2% | +0.0% |
| 2023 | 99.2% | -0.0% |
| 2024 | 99.3% | +0.1% |
